A beautiful move was made by KAE Panathinaikos before the jumble of the confrontation with the Maccabi Tel Aviv for the Euroleague.
The “greens” awarded the Paralympian Naso Gavelawho was at OAKA as an official guest, even receiving as a gift from Vassilis Parthenopoulos a team shirt with the signatures of all players.
Who is Nasos Gavelas?
THE Nassos Gavelas was born on December 19, 1999 and always dreamed of becoming a successful athlete. From a very young age he showed his inclination towards sports by trying many sports, but athletics was the sport that won his heart. Around the age of ten, his genetic disease appeared Stargardt, which gradually caused his vision to decline. Despite the significant challenges faced by a visually impaired athlete, he managed to win the gold medal at the 2021 Paralympic Games in Tokyo.
In 2017 he participated in the first major event, the World Championships in Athletics for the Disabled in London, where he took 10th and 14th place in the 100m and 200m. respectively, of the T12 category, with times of 11.39” and 23.26”. A year later he competed in the European Championships in Berlin, where he won Gold 100m medal (T12) with a performance of 11.47” and became the youngest athlete to be named European Champion in his category. In the same event, he also won the silver medal in the 200m. with a time of 23.20”. This was followed by his participation in the 2019 Dubai World Championships, where he finished eighth in the 100m. and then switched to the T11 category, where he participated in races with a driver.
In June 2021 he won the gold medal in European Championship in Bydgosz and at the same time noted new Pan-European 100m record (10.98”). A few months later he won the gold medal at the Paralympic Games in Tokyo, setting a new world record (10.82”) in the 100m. in category T11.
